Title: Observation of large magnetocaloric effect in HoRu{sub 2}Si{sub 2}

Detailed magnetic, magnetotransport, and magnetocaloric measurements on HoRu{sub 2}Si{sub 2} have been performed. In this Letter, we report presence of spin reorientation transition below paramagnetic to antiferromagnetic transition temperature (T{sub N} = 19 K). Large magnetic entropy change 9.1 J/kg K and large negative magnetoresistance ∼21% in a magnetic field of 5 T has been observed around T{sub N}, which is associated with field induced spin-flip metamagnetic transition.
